| Title |
Simulated conformation ensembles for chromatin for eight developmental stages from HPSC cells based on DNase-seq data |
| Description |
In our work, we develop a polymer-physics-based hypothesis-driven model, noted as our stochastic folding model. This model predicts the conformation ensemble of a chromatin region of interest by using only the population-averaged chromatin accessibility data as input. We use stochastic folding model to construct the conformation ensemble for two chromatin regions: chr11:15Mb-25Mb and chr12:105Mb-115Mb. For each cell, the conformation ensemble is generated using the DNase-seq data |
